China Makes use of Gravitational Slingshots to Rescue Two Satellites Caught in Orbit for 123 Days

In a serious show of technical ingenuity, China has efficiently rescued two satellites—DRO-A and DRO-B—that had been caught within the mistaken orbit for 123 days following a launch failure. The satellites, a part of China’s distant retrograde orbit (DRO) constellation, had been saved utilizing a collection of advanced gravitational slingshot manoeuvres that turned a near-disaster right into a milestone in house navigation. This restoration mission not solely preserved vital {hardware} but in addition highlighted China’s rising experience in orbital mechanics, house rescue operations, and deep-space navigation applied sciences.

Progressive Pondering in vital situation

In accordance with a current story by CGTN, on March 15, 2024, China launched two satellites that had been mounted on a Lengthy March-2C rocket with a Yuanzheng-1S higher stage. Whereas the launch initially appeared to achieve success, a malfunction within the higher stage made the satellites tumble and head in direction of Earth a lot nearer than deliberate. With restricted energy and broken programs, typical restoration was inconceivable.

Zhang Hao, a researcher on the Expertise and Engineering Heart for Area Utilisation (CSU), described the second the staff discovered of the difficulty in an interview with CGTN Digital: “If the satellites had been destroyed, that might have been a waste of the years of effort that we put in and the cash invested within the mission. It will even be a psychological blow to the staff.”

CSU engineers divided into two groups—one labored to stabilise the spinning satellites, whereas Zhang’s staff centered on calculating a brand new trajectory utilizing gravitational assists. “We calculated the perfect route to maneuver the satellites again on observe,” Zhang defined throughout the interview.

A Gravity-Assisted Comeback

The mission exploited the gravitational pulls of Earth, the Moon, and even the Solar to fastidiously nudge the satellites into their goal DRO positions. The approach is often utilized in deep house missions, and it wants a minimal quantity of gas, which makes it a possible method to bypass the gas scarcity. Essentially the most vital manoeuvre lasted simply 20 minutes however took weeks of preparation. “I obtained increasingly harassed because the clock ticked,” Zhang admitted. “I simply stored staring on the display screen till it stated ‘regular, ‘” he additional added.

Now efficiently positioned, DRO-A and DRO-B have joined the sooner DRO-L to kind a three-satellite constellation. In accordance with CSU researcher Mao Xinyuan, the community will drastically scale back spacecraft positioning instances—from days to only a few hours—and help autonomous navigation between Earth and the Moon.

This mission not solely salvaged helpful satellites but in addition demonstrated China’s rising functionality in autonomous spaceflight and long-distance orbital engineering.
